Sobre este artículo

London: Co-published by The British Library and Oak Knoll Press, 1996 .. Fourth revised edition. A very clean book, with illustrated dustwrapper. Brown cloth boards with gilt titles to spine. Glossy dutwrapper in very good condition, just light rubbing to edges. pp.xiii/pp.372 + 14 plates. VG/VG . ** Colophon to verso of the title-page: "Originally published in 1963 by Hafner Publishing Company , Uk. Second and third supplemented editions, 1978 and 1988 by The Holland Press, Ltd. UK. This fourth expanded and revised edition was co-published by the British Libray and Oak Knoll Press in 1996."
